They are the guts of the ship-borne Aegis Combat System and the Patriot Missile System. The large redundancy related to having numerous array elements will increase reliability at the expense of gradual efficiency degradation that occurs as particular person section parts fail. To a lesser extent, Phased array radars have been utilized in weather surveillance. As of 2017, NOAA plans to implement a national community of Multi-Function Phased array radars all through the United States inside 10 years, for meteorological studies and flight monitoring.

The Nauchnoissledovatel’skii ispytalel’nyi institut svyazi RKKA (NIIIS-KA, Scientific Research Institute of Signals of the Red Army), had initially opposed research in radio-location, favoring as a substitute acoustical techniques. However, this portion of the Red Army gained power on account of the Great Purge, and did an about face, pressing hard for fast development of radio-location systems. They took over Oshchepkov’s laboratory and have been made answerable for all current and future agreements for research and manufacturing facility production. Writing later about the Purge and subsequent results, General Lobanov commented that it led to the development being placed underneath a single group, and the fast reorganization of the work.

The first vital software of this know-how was in ground-penetrating radar . Developed in the 1970s, GPR is now used for structural foundation analysis, archeological mapping, treasure looking, unexploded ordnance identification, and different shallow investigations. This is possible because impulse radar can concisely locate the boundaries between the final media and the specified target.
The war precipitated research to search out better resolution, extra portability, and extra options for radar, including complementary navigation methods like Oboe utilized by the RAF’s Pathfinder. A key development was the cavity magnetron within the UK, which allowed the creation of relatively small systems with sub-meter decision. By early 1939, NTRI/JRC had jointly developed a ten-cm (3-GHz), secure-frequency Mandarin-kind magnetron (No. M3) that, with water cooling, could produce 500-W energy. In the same time interval, magnetrons were built with 10 and 12 cavities operating as little as zero.7 cm . The configuration of the M3 magnetron was primarily the identical as that used later in the magnetron developed by Boot and Randall at Birmingham University in early 1940, including the advance of strapped cavities.
